एवमेकाग्रचित्तः सन्संस्मरन्मधुसूदनम् ।जन्ममृत्युजराग्राहं संसाराब्धिं तरिष्यति ॥
In plain words
Thus with a single-minded focus, constantly remembering Madhusūdana, one will cross beyond the ocean of worldly existence whose snapping crocodiles are birth, old age, and death.
Close to the Sanskrit
Thus being with a one-pointed mind, remembering Madhusūdana, he will cross the ocean of saṃsāra whose alligator is birth, death, and old age.
